Kodinsk

Town in Krasnoyarsk Krai, Russia

Kodinsk is a town and the administrative center of Kezhemsky District of Krasnoyarsk Krai, Russia, located on the Angara River, 735 kilometers (457 mi) north of Krasnoyarsk. Population: 14,830 (2010 Russian census); 14,746 (2002 Census); 14,050 (1989 Soviet census).
